0 / 0 / 0
Регистрация: 04.02.2023
Сообщений: 6

8-ми битный ПК на процессоре Z80 и статической ОЗУ на ОС СР/М

21.03.2024, 15:59. Показов 2664. Ответов 9
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
8-ми битный ПК на процессоре Z80 и статической памяти. Предполагается вывод экранной области ОЗУ в разрешении 400 Х 256 при двух точках на байт ( 8 цветов и 2 градации яркости ). Изображение занимает 64 килобайта и делится на 4 страницы по 16 килобайт. Видео память при этом не полностью используется. Для увеличения разрешения до 512 Х 256 требуется частота вывода пикселей 5 МГц ( в данной схеме 4 МГц ).
Размещение: На основной плате размещены - процессор, буферы шин, и шина для установки плат. Платы ОЗУ, буферы портов, дешифраторы памяти и портов - устанавливаются в основную плату. Плата буферов, счётчиков видеопамяти - в одной плоскости с основной платой. Плата управления располагается сбоку от шины в одной плоскости с основной платой. Внешнее подключение к шинам этого ПК через 2 разъёма DB-25F, D-Sub socket гнездо 25pin. Требуется создание Gerber файлов совместимых с KiCad 5.1.12 для печатных плат.
Миниатюры
8-ми битный ПК на процессоре Z80 и статической ОЗУ на ОС СР/М   8-ми битный ПК на процессоре Z80 и статической ОЗУ на ОС СР/М   8-ми битный ПК на процессоре Z80 и статической ОЗУ на ОС СР/М  

8-ми битный ПК на процессоре Z80 и статической ОЗУ на ОС СР/М   8-ми битный ПК на процессоре Z80 и статической ОЗУ на ОС СР/М   8-ми битный ПК на процессоре Z80 и статической ОЗУ на ОС СР/М  

Вложения
Тип файла: rar ПК на процессоре Z80.rar (3.74 Мб, 12 просмотров)
0
cpp_developer
Эксперт
20123 / 5690 / 1417
Регистрация: 09.04.2010
Сообщений: 22,546
Блог
21.03.2024, 15:59
Ответы с готовыми решениями:

5.99гб озу из 8 на новом процессоре
всем привет, у меня возникла проблемка надеюсь кто-нибудь да поможет в решении, у меня был комп мамка: gygabyte ga-p55ud3l cpu: i3...

В свойствах системы нет данных о процессоре и ОЗУ
Столкнулся с такой проблемой, перестали отображаться данные о процессоре и ОЗУ. Нагуглив вопрос, первым делом проверил включены ли службы...

Будет ли работать 2 плашки озу если на плате и на процессоре трехканал?
Хочу поставить больше озу на пк, мать трехканальная, проц тоже, будет ли нормально работать озу в двухканале?

9
3688 / 2575 / 575
Регистрация: 11.09.2009
Сообщений: 9,252
23.03.2024, 00:15
Цитата Сообщение от Sergrdmen Посмотреть сообщение
Требуется создание Gerber файлов
Так с этим не сюда, а сюда.
0
515 / 756 / 98
Регистрация: 23.11.2021
Сообщений: 4,356
Записей в блоге: 10
23.03.2024, 00:40
О, вспомнил журналы "Радио" эпохи моего детсада…
В наше время таких динозавров делать вообще смысла нет, т.к. ту же Z80 элементарно эмулируют на самых попсовых STM32… Ну и под ПК эмуляторы есть - можно запросто запустить игрульку, чем китайцы и пользуются в своих копеечных (сам не так давно за 375 рублей дочке купил) "эмуляторах" (правда, там по большей части игры из "денди" и "сеги", ну и немножко под "спектрум" присутствуют).
Ну и вот советую ТСу сравнить: сколько будет стоить его эмулятор Z80 на этой адской рассыпухе с китайским эмулятором нескольких популярных 8-битных приставок (еще и со встроенными экранчиком и клавиатурой).
0
0 / 0 / 0
Регистрация: 04.02.2023
Сообщений: 6
23.03.2024, 10:43  [ТС]
Нужен простой ПК на Z80 на ОС СР/М с 16 портами входа и выхода с экраном не менее 400 Х 256 при двух точках на байт ( 8 цветов и 2 градации яркости ) в упрощённом виде можно экранные данные передавать на ноутбук или планшет через Usb-Uart
используя HyperTerminal. То есть ПК должен быть на подобие - "CP/M RC2014" но только с другой компоновкой шины, и расположением плат.
0
0 / 0 / 0
Регистрация: 04.02.2023
Сообщений: 6
28.03.2024, 16:09  [ТС]
В качестве буферов шины адреса используются регистры КР1533ИР33, в качестве буфера шины данных используется КР1533АП6. Для предотвращения случайных замыканий и перегрузок (конфликтов) на шинах, возможно использование ограничителей тока (источники стабильного тока) по линии питания для каждой микросхемы-формирователя шин адреса и данных.
0
0 / 0 / 0
Регистрация: 04.02.2023
Сообщений: 6
08.04.2024, 20:23  [ТС]
Вариант Схемы с упрощённым обращения ЦП к видео ОЗУ. Недостаток такого варианта в том, что во время обращения ЦП к видео ОЗУ на экране возникают артефакты в виде полос длиной 4 пикселя.
Миниатюры
8-ми битный ПК на процессоре Z80 и статической ОЗУ на ОС СР/М  
0
0 / 0 / 0
Регистрация: 04.02.2023
Сообщений: 6
10.05.2024, 20:47  [ТС]
Краткое описание схемы управления.
Вложения
Тип файла: rar 8-ми битный ПК краткое описание схемы.rar (476.5 Кб, 5 просмотров)
0
 Аватар для sporta1982
54 / 51 / 7
Регистрация: 05.10.2023
Сообщений: 415
24.05.2024, 15:04
Есть еще романтики в русских селеньях....
0
Native x86
Эксперт Hardware
 Аватар для quwy
6801 / 3735 / 1020
Регистрация: 13.02.2013
Сообщений: 11,739
26.05.2024, 02:54
Чего критикуете? Человек собственную ЭВМ разработал, на убогой советской рассыпухе, причем. Не многие "айтишники" нынче на такое способны.
1
 Аватар для sporta1982
54 / 51 / 7
Регистрация: 05.10.2023
Сообщений: 415
26.05.2024, 08:06
Дело не в этом, я не критикую , тот кто действительно понимает он сделает, вы просто не найдете многих микросхем(

Добавлено через 2 минуты
Я знаю что такое Sinclair and scorpion привет из прошлого

Добавлено через 11 минут
если такие "айтишники" , которые не могут это сделать что там за айтишники, поколение следующее лучше

Добавлено через 2 минуты
это мотивация, радиолюбительство я не коим образом не хотел кого то обидеть....

Добавлено через 8 минут
кстати был такой Зонов он именно разрабатывал Scorpion, я мелкий еще был просто ездили за дискетами))
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
raxper
Эксперт
30234 / 6612 / 1498
Регистрация: 28.12.2010
Сообщений: 21,154
Блог
26.05.2024, 08:06
Помогаю со студенческими работами здесь

WIX Как добавить в реестр 32 битный ключ, если инсталлер 64 битный?
Имеется: <Package InstallerVersion="200" Compressed="yes" SummaryCodepage="1251" Platform="x64" ...

Как на 64-битный ноут установить 32-битный XP?
Как на 64- битный ноут установить 32-битный XP?

Преобразовать 8-битный bmp в 24-битный
помогите!!!вообще не имею понятия как это сделать:wall:

Проблема с взаимодействием динамической и статической памяти - обращение к статической переменной
Здравствуйте! Помогите решить проблему! Задача такая: написать сортировку бинарным деревом, так что бы данные читались из текстового...

Объявление статической переменной и статической функции в классе
Добрый вечер, столкнулся с проблемой и не могу решить. Есть класс SavingsAccount и в нем объявлена статическая переменная для процентной...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
10
Ответ Создать тему
Опции темы

Новые блоги и статьи
Тестирование энергоэффективности и скорости вычислений видеокарт в BOINC проектах
Programma_Boinc 08.07.2025
Тестирование энергоэффективности и скорости вычислений видеокарт в BOINC проектах Опубликовано: 07. 07. 2025 Рубрика: Uncategorized Автор: AlexA Статья размещается на сайте с разрешения. . .
Раскрываем внутренние механики Android с помощью контекста и манифеста
mobDevWorks 07.07.2025
Каждый Android-разработчик сталкивается с Context и манифестом буквально в первый день работы. Но много ли мы задумываемся о том, что скрывается за этими обыденными элементами? Я, честно говоря,. . .
API на базе FastAPI с Python за пару минут
AI_Generated 07.07.2025
FastAPI - это относительно молодой фреймворк для создания веб-API, который за короткое время заработал бешеную популярность в Python-сообществе. И не зря. Я помню, как впервые запустил приложение на. . .
Основы WebGL. Раскрашивание вершин с помощью VBO
8Observer8 05.07.2025
На русском https:/ / vkvideo. ru/ video-231374465_456239020 На английском https:/ / www. youtube. com/ watch?v=oskqtCrWns0 Исходники примера:
Мониторинг микросервисов с OpenTelemetry в Kubernetes
Mr. Docker 04.07.2025
Проблема наблюдаемости (observability) в Kubernetes - это не просто вопрос сбора логов или метрик. Это целый комплекс вызовов, которые возникают из-за самой природы контейнеризации и оркестрации. К. . .
Проблемы с Kotlin и Wasm при создании игры
GameUnited 03.07.2025
В современном мире разработки игр выбор технологии - это зачастую балансирование между удобством разработки, переносимостью и производительностью. Когда я решил создать свою первую веб-игру, мой. . .
Создаем микросервисы с Go и Kubernetes
golander 02.07.2025
Когда я только начинал с микросервисами, все спорили о том, какой язык юзать. Сейчас Go (или Golang) фактически захватил эту нишу. И вот почему этот язык настолько заходит для этих задач: . . .
C++23, квантовые вычисления и взаимодействие с Q#
bytestream 02.07.2025
Я всегда с некоторым скептицизмом относился к громким заявлениям о революциях в IT, но квантовые вычисления - это тот случай, когда революция действительно происходит прямо у нас на глазах. Последние. . .
Вот в чем сила LM.
Hrethgir 02.07.2025
как на английском будет “обслуживание“ Слово «обслуживание» на английском языке может переводиться несколькими способами в зависимости от контекста: * **Service** — самый распространённый. . .
Использование Keycloak со Spring Boot и интеграция Identity Provider
Javaican 01.07.2025
Два года назад я получил задачу, которая сначала показалась тривиальной: интегрировать корпоративную аутентификацию в микросервисную архитектуру. На тот момент у нас было семь Spring Boot приложений,.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2025, CyberForum.ru